Camaro Sweater Pattern by Tanis Lavallee



The yardage requirements for this sweater will vary widely depending on the way you choose to approach the stripes and whether you are knitting the cropped vs. hip length version or the 3/4 vs. full length sleeves.

Total yardage for full length body and sleeves: 5 (5, 6,
6, 6, 7, 7) 8, 8, 9, 10, 11, 12) skeins 1250 (1300, 1450,
1500, 1550, 1700, 1800) 1900, 2000, 2300, 2500, 2700,
2900 yards Tanis Fiber Arts PureWash DK Weight yarn
(113 g = 260 yds).

For an even width stripe using 8 contrasting colours you will need between 25 & 50 yards of the cast on colour (smallest sizes vs. largest sizes) and 75 & 125 yards of the last stripe colour with the remainder of the yardage to be made up by your Main Colour.

From Tanis: 

If you are uncertain which size you should make I’d recommend going down a size for a good fit across the chest. Due to the biasing of the fabric in the yoke combined with the slight A-line created when you switch to the body portion the fit seems to air on the side of generous. Many knitters have had great success when sizing down rather than sizing up. Happy stitching!
